Seth F.

Seth F.

Java Web Programming Consultant

Hatfield , United States

Experience: 21 Years

Seth

Hatfield , United States

Java Web Programming Consultant

96000 USD / Year

  • Immediate: Available

21 Years

Now you can Instantly Chat with Seth!

About Me

SkillsLanguages Java(1.4 - 7), HTML/XHTML, JavaScript, Cascading Style Sheets (CSS), C++, SQL, PL/SQL, PHP,Perl, Borland/Inprise Delphi 5.0, T-SQLTechnologies AJAX, SOAP/REST (Web Services), XML(XPath, XSLT), DHTML, UML, BOSS(Business ObjectsShared S...

Show More

Portfolio Projects

Description

-Premise: I had an external hard drive with literature I wrote, my resume & references, ISOs for various
software I ripped (usually from CDs & DVDs I own but no longer keep around in physical form such as a Debian
Linux full install ISO) & my Windows 10 Professional Install/Setup DVD. The drive was failing & especially
for the ISOs Windows kept restarting a move from the very beginning while trying to move things off – when the
drive would become inaccessible, I’d remove the cable & reinsert it but then the file on which it was moving
was to begin to move from the very beginning of the file. This program allows the user(me in this case) to move
the files from a configured location to another configured location & as configured, resume from last position if
the file copy is halted or stalled & subsequently resumed.
-Project involves a desktop GUI application
-Technologies: C++ 11, QT(5),, Standard Library(fstream/iostream)

Show More Show Less

Description

-Worked on a project to handle the escheatment activities for the firm’s prior activities in Canada
- Project’s tasks involved writing a Java REST endpoint that inevitably created an Excel file using Apache POI library w/ details about errors from a previous import; as well as importing from another Excel file & processing a bulk update in the details & Audit History tables.
-Technologies: Java(8), Spring(5 – Core, ORM, Web, MVC, REST, Boot), iBatis, JUnit(4), Oracle(12)

Show More Show Less

Description

-Premise: Application allows user to enter URLs of various Torrent sites and the application will crawl the sites
looking for and compiling a list of torrents and the names of said repositories to be downloaded, and then
provides an interface for those torrents to be automatically downloaded and renamed given programmable rules
to a configurable location(drive/path). Additionally, it serves as a database of media(movies, TV shows/series,
books/e-books, and music/mp3s. Finally it allows in the entries for certain types of media the ability to view or
listen to said media (for example listening to an mp3 or watching a movie or reading an e-book)
-Project involves/d a desktop GUI application
-Technologies: C++ 11, QT(5), MySQL(8), LibTorrent(C++ BitTorrent library), Stazer/Crawler(C++ Web Crawling
library)

Show More Show Less

Description

-Wrote code to demo a test environment for client’s application using JSUnit
-Modified page templates in ordering web application for Comcast client in JSRender, Javascript, HTML, & CSS
-Technologies: Java(8), Spring(5 – Core, Web, MVC, REST, Boot), Javascript(ES5), JSRender, jsUnit

Show More Show Less

Description

-Premise: Application handles ushering and communion schedules for consistory members allowing those who
plan the schedules to import or dynamically create schedules, those who need to replace with someone to log in
and do so, and those others to view and/or print the schedules either to paper or to PDF or similar at their leisure
-Project involves/d a web application, Android and iPhone application
-Technologies: Java(started at 8, ended at 11), Spring(4-5), Hibernate(4), MySQL(8), Tomcat(8), Maven(3),
Apache Common Libs, iText, PDFBox, Log4j, Slf4j, jUnit, jsUnit, Amazon Web Services(AWS): EC2 instance

Show More Show Less

Description

-Attended meetings for Single Sign-on(SSO) to be used within the school district’s portal & to assess/gather technical
& functional requirements for refactoring of Document Management System
-Re-engineered application responsible for student disciplinary record maintenance for the sake of maintenance & readability of code
-Technologies: Java(7), Servlets/JSP, HTML(5), CSS(3), Javascript(ES5), jQuery(2), CVS for Source Control

Show More Show Less

Description

-Responsible for both original development & issue repairs of various web applications
-Converted several sections of the application from a page by page design to a design heavily utilizing AJAX using jQuery
& retrofitting with HTML5 when possible
-Drastically improved efficiency both in memory and speed in legacy nightly job suffering from memory leaks and time
issues
-Advised in Java(6, 7), Oracle, & Javascript matters to the VP of Technology & Senior Programmer
-Responsible for restarting servers on occasion when & if they froze up for a client.
-Applied logging functionality to many of the apps on the portal
-Technologies: Java(8)/J2EE, JBoss, Struts(1.1), EJB, Hibernate(3), JPA, Oracle(9), Subversion(SVN) for Source Control

Show More Show Less